1.4. 新的 Debezium 功能


Debezium 1.9.7 包括以下更新:

1.4.1. 提升到正式发行(GA)的功能

在 2022.Q3 版本的更新中,以下功能从技术预览推广为正式发布:

支持 Oracle Real Application 集群
Oracle 的 Debezium 连接器现在支持用于 Oracle Real Application Clusters (RAC)。

在 2022.Q3 版本中,以下功能从技术预览推广为正式发布:

临时和增量和快照
提供重新运行您之前捕获快照的表快照的机制。
Debezium Oracle 连接器

现在,在配置为使用 LogMiner 的数据库上完全支持 Oracle 数据库的连接器。此版本的 Oracle 连接器包括以下更新:

  • DBZ-3317 描述 十进制.handling.mode 属性的文档现在与其他 Debezium 连接器的类似文档一致。
  • DBZ-4404 现在支持使用信号在早于 12c 的 Oracle 版本触发临时快照。
  • DBZ-4436/ DBZ-4883 现在描述了如何将 Oracle JDBC 驱动程序作为 Maven 工件获取。
  • DBZ-4494 文档描述了如何为 Oracle connector LogMiner 用户设置数据库权限。
  • DBZ-4536 提高 Oracle 连接器错误处理程序的灵活性,以重试在 mining 会话期间发生的错误。
  • DBZ-4595 Oracle 连接器现在支持 'ROWID' 数据类型。
  • DBZ-4963 Introduce log.mining.session.max.ms 配置选项用于 Oracle 连接器。
  • 在调整 LogMiner 批处理大小时,现在新大小基于当前的批处理大小,而不是默认大小。https://issues.redhat.com/browse/DBZ-5005
  • DBZ-5119 用户可以配置连接器,以发出心跳事件,以确保连接器偏移在延长时间段内没有发生改变的表中保持同步。
  • DBZ-5225 现在包括 LogMiner 事件 SCN,Oracle 更改事件记录中包括,以防止在间隔期间连接器在间隔期间发出的情况与低水水位线 SCN 值相同。
  • 在快照阶段,无法在连接器启动过程中发现不正确的删除归档日志时,DBZ-5256 以防止失败,Oracle 连接器不再默认使用检查不完整事务的进度。
  • signal.data.collection 属性的 DBZ-5399 更新文档在可插拔数据库环境中指定 属性的值必须设置为 root 数据库的名称。

    有关作为技术预览引入的 Oracle 连接器功能列表,请查看 2022.Q1 发行注记
Outbox 事件路由器
单一消息转换(SMT),用于安全可靠地交换多个(micro)服务之间的数据。
将信号发送到 Debezium 连接器
Debezium 信号机制提供了一种方式来修改连接器的行为,或触发连接器来执行一次性操作,如启动表的临时增量快照。
返回顶部
Red Hat logoGithubredditYoutubeTwitter

学习

尝试、购买和销售

社区

关于红帽文档

通过我们的产品和服务,以及可以信赖的内容,帮助红帽用户创新并实现他们的目标。 了解我们当前的更新.

让开源更具包容性

红帽致力于替换我们的代码、文档和 Web 属性中存在问题的语言。欲了解更多详情,请参阅红帽博客.

關於紅帽

我们提供强化的解决方案,使企业能够更轻松地跨平台和环境(从核心数据中心到网络边缘)工作。

Theme

© 2026 Red Hat